Description

Lovelle offer to market this immaculate four bedroom detached house located on Laceby Road, situated on the sought-after outskirts of Grimsby town centre. This substantial and superbly presented home provides generous accommodation for families, with an array of amenities and scenic green spaces nearby.

Upon entering, you are welcomed into a hall with travertine tiled flooring, oak panelled walls, and a crafted oak balustrade staircase leading to the first floor. Off the hallway is a cloakroom fitted with a WC and sink for added convenience.

The ground floor features five versatile reception rooms, offering flexible living and work-from-home options. The living room benefits from oak flooring, a gas fire, bay window, and far-reaching views across fields. The open plan kitchen/diner impresses with fitted oak units, larder cupboards, a five-ring hob and oven, space for an American-style fridge, plumbing for a dishwasher and washing machine, and a spacious breakfast room with an island dining table and built-in wine rack. The garden room, with its oak flooring and direct garden access, provides further flexible living space, while a dedicated study offers built-in storage and potential use as an additional bedroom. 

Upstairs, the principal bedroom is a generous double featuring built-in wardrobes, oak flooring, an en-suite with shower and sink/vanity unit, as well as access to a roof terrace. Two further double bedrooms with built-in wardrobes and oak flooring, and a spacious single bedroom with built-in storage, are serviced by a family bathroom boasting attractive tiles, a corner bath with shower over, vanity unit and WC.

The exterior is equally impressive, with a large driveway providing ample parking, a generous and well-stocked garden featuring fruit trees, a watering system, and a brick-built workshop/garden room suitable for a variety of uses, including home business. The property is uPVC double glazed and gas central heated with new windows installed throughout in 2019.

Located opposite Bradley fields, this home is ideal for families seeking both tranquillity and accessibility. The area is well served by reputable local schools and daily amenities, while Grimsby town centre’s shops, cafés, and leisure facilities are just a short distance away. Regular bus services operate along Laceby Road, connecting to Grimsby Town centre where you will also find the railway station, which offers train links to Cleethorpes in under 10 minutes and to cities such as Lincoln and Doncaster in under an hour. The nearby A46 provides further road links for commuting.
